About

Foretoken is a tool to scrape and defend against potential dangerous threats faced on the internet. It aims to be a highly customizable tools for companies and individuals to use to counter threats.

Features

  • Emails (Rest/gRPC)
    • Disposable
    • Generic
    • Free
    • Spam
  • IPs (Rest/gRPC)
    • VPN
    • Spam
    • Proxy
    • Tor
  • Score (Rest/gRPC)
  • Database
    • SQLite
    • PostgreSQL
  • Editable Sources
    • You can edit all sources

Usage

Migrate

If using NON-MEMORY SQLITE or PostgreSQL, DO THIS BEFORE YOU RUN, You need to migrate the database:

make migrate

How to run

To run it on your local computer:

git clone https://github.com/domgolonka/foretoken
cd ./foretoken
make build && ./bin/foretoken

The default config file is config.yml. If you want to run it with a different config file (or add your own).

git clone https://github.com/domgolonka/foretoken make build (make sure to build it first)

./bin/foretoken --config=/PATH/TO/CONFIG

example: ./bin/foretoken --config=./config.prod.yml

Docker

You can run it in docker, locally:

docker build -t foretoken .

Once the image is built, Foretoken can be invoked by running the following:

docker run --rm -t -p 8080:8080 foretoken

Or run Docker from our repo:

docker run -d -p 8080:8080 domgolonka/foretoken

or with a custom config file:

docker run -d -p 8080:8080 domgolonka/foretoken --config=config.yml

Change the databases

At this moment, Foretoken only supports SQLite and PostgreSQL. You can change the databasename field with either postgresql or sqlite3

By Default, the SQLite driver is set to "in memory". To use a file, you need to specify that the host to a .sqlite3 extension, example: YOURNAME.sqlite3. This will create a new SQLite file in the root directory.

For Postgresql, I would advise using a quick read/write database like timescale.

PostgreSQL is not yet tested

Score

The overall Fraud Score of the email and IP's reputation and recent behavior across the threat network. Fraud Scores >= 75 are suspicious, but not necessarily fraudulent.

Source

All sources are available in the ./resource directory. You can edit and the resources. They files get checked once a day by the different modules.

Regular Expressions

Regex expressions are saved in the ./resource/expressions.json file in JSON format.

Each regex looks like this:

{
"name": "ipv4",
"expression": "^((?:(?:25[0-5]|2[0-4][0-9]|[01]?[0-9][0-9]?)\\.){3}(?:25[0-5]|2[0-4][0-9]|[01]?[0-9][0-9]?)).*",
"type": "ipv4"
},

Name: The UNIQUE name of the regular expression.

Expression: The regex

Type: The type of expression. For IPs, it is usually is a ipv4 or ipv6. For IP proxy, its http, https, sock4, sock5.

The files are stored in the ./resource directory and start with ip_ such as ip_tor for tor.

You can add sources by adding a new file to ./resource directory and updating the config.yml file:

### Resource files
resource:
  emaildisposallist: [ "email_disposable" ]
  emailfreelist: [ "email_free" ]
  emailspamlist: [ "email_spam" ]
  ipvpnlist: [ "ip_vpn" ]
  ipopenvpnlist: [ "ip_openvpn" ]
  iptorlist: [ "ip_tor" ]
  ipproxylist: [ "ip_proxy" ]
  ipspamlist: [ "ip_spam" ]
  expressionlist: [ "expressions" ]

Rate Limiting

You can enable the rate limiter for REST API in the config.yml file.

ratelimit:
  enabled: true
  max: 20 
  expiration: 30 

Max number of recent connections during Duration seconds before sending a 429 response

Expiration is the time on how long to keep records of requests in memory per minute

Service Discovery

Foretoken supports etcd3, zookeeper, and consul as a registry.

All service discovery configurations are stored in the config.yml file:

servicediscovery:
  service: ""
  nodeid: ""
  endpoint: ""
  • Service: The viable options are consul, etc3 and zookeeper
  • Nodeid: A name for the grpc nodeid
  • endpoint: An address for the service such as zookeeper: 10.0.101.68:2189, etcd: http://10.0.101.68:2379 or consul: http://10.0.101.68:8500

Metrics

Prometheus

Prometheus is enabled. Following metrices are available by default:

http_requests_total
http_request_duration_seconds
http_requests_in_progress_total
